πMonthly costs for one person with rent: $1,034 in Medellin versus $953 in Alba Iulia.
πEstimated couple costs with rent: $1,577 in Medellin versus $1,460 in Alba Iulia.
πMonthly costs for a family of three with rent: $2,120 in Medellin versus $1,967 in Alba Iulia.
πLiving in Medellin is roughly 8% more expensive than Alba Iulia, driven mainly by Eating Out.
πBoth cities sit below the global median: Medellin23% lower, Alba Iulia29% lower.
